The Science of Human Behavior Is Not Physiology
The aim of behaviorism to study human action from without with the methods of animal psychology is illusory. The fact that animals and even plants react in a quasi purposeful way is neither more nor less miraculous than that man thinks and acts. Without praxeological categories, we would be at a loss to conceive and to understand the behavior,. both of animals and of infants.
